Pushing Boundaries features a selection of abstract large format paintings made by artists currently enrolled in the Large Scale Painting class at HPAC instructed by Chicago painter Darrell Roberts. The Large Scale Painting class focuses on developing a new appreciation for large format paintings. Roberts encourages his students to remain involved with the art-making process outside of the classroom. Students are urged to get involved with the Chicago art scene, visit galleries, and explore the new trends in contemporary painting. Back in the studio, the students share new ideas, critique their work regularly, and encourage each other to push their painting to new heights. The artists in Roberts’ class come from a variety of backgrounds. Some previously studied art at schools such as the Pratt Institute (NY) and the School of the Art Institute of Chicago. Others have produced murals with the Chicago Public Art Group, and achieved success in creative fields including interior design. These artists are experimenting with paints in ways that they never had before. The majority of the students are revisiting a painting practice put on hold, while a few are even working with paint for the first time.

Featured Artists
Lisa Brunke, Astrid Fuller, Diane Jurado, Nate Kalichman, Jan Lindell, Barbette Loevy, Judy Petacque, Diane Ponder, and Susan Redeker.
